Dogs Got My Back

12/3/2017

0 Comments

 
Picture
Growing up in San Agustin, on the outskirts of Acapulco, Guerrero state, Mexico was tough. Violent crimes such as murders skyrocketed as unconscionable gangs took out people at will and did it at random. Many of the take downs were gang and drug related. A lot of times innocent people became victims for just standing too close to who the gang members were after. The killers were relentless, the cops were exhausted, and some became corrupt by taking sides with many high profile drug dealers who had their scouts controlling the streets. Life for me in San Agustin was horrific. You could not simply walk to the grocery store without worrying that you may get robbed and beaten or shot and killed.

The worst thing is that these subhuman who killed and sold drugs in the streets had no remorse whatsoever. They also used their drugs money to influence youth as small as seven(7) years old to begin selling drugs and carrying guns. The fear was thick on the streets as you could be sure that there would be a kidnapping following a beheading by the end of the week. Many who walked freely without fear were either gang members or the police who knew that they were on the cartel's payroll. If you wanted to live, if you wanted to eat, if you wanted to walk, you had to roll with the toughest dogs you could find. I found my two dogs who always had my back. Both are mixed breeds, Venom, which is the larger dog is mixed with his mother being a golden retriever and his dad being a Rottweiler. Nica, the smallest is mixed with her dad being a poodle and mom being a Shih-tzu. These two dogs are the only defense I rolled with, and let me tell you, they always had my back.
Venom DogVenom is an adventurous dog who loved his home and his family. He was quiet and friendly, but knew when to execute ferociousness when the time was right on unscrupulous gang members who plagued the streets. Venom was a no nonsense dog who simply wanted to see the streets cleanup of all the drugs and guns. He was known by the Cartels and his presence patrolling the streets placed things in some order as any gang-member who dared to commit and act of crime when venom was out would be sniffed out, chased, cornered and brought before the court of law. They knew better than to try and resist arrest because that would end up really nasty. Those who had the experience of getting a few bites here and there know better than to mess with this law abiding canine. Venom knew the streets, he knew the trees, a few shop walls and fire hydrants really well if you know what I mean. He left his mark and his scent on all graffiti that the gang members used to deface the community. This dog was on the hit list of the cartels because they said he disrespected them. Venom knew, but he stood for something and knew that innocent people relied on him to have some spark in the dark world they lived. His name entered the hit list because he flatly turned down a bribe by both cartels. They offered him lifetime supplies of dog foods of the highest quality, dog treats in the millions, a large dog house, and the best vet service money could buy. And of course, female dogs flocking at his paw. This was a tempting offer to any male dog, many would simply accept and go live the life. But once you have been bought by the Cartels, you will remain their property until the day you die. Venom was a dog with integrity and commitment. No amount of free dog food and fire hydrants in the world could bring him over to the side of unlawfulness.
Nica DogNica was a very cute female dog and she used her charm and wits to get every bit of information needed to help bust many drug operations. She was basically the one who was in charge of intelligence gathering and she did her job well and with class. She sported a much friendlier personality compared to her compatriot Venom. They were the best of friends. But that friendship was kept a secret for ten (10) long years and counting. Nica could not afford to not be friends with many of the degenerates of the city as well as those who were held in high esteem. If they knew that she was working with us, she would become targeted and the information she so easily garnished would be cut off immediately. Her role as a intelligence dog was extremely important and even much more dangerous than Venom who the enforcer. Gang members hated snitches and if they ever found out Nica was basically snitching on their operations, they would pursue her endlessly until they were either expired or she was.
She was beautiful, she was the life of the party, she mixed and mingled and was simply adored. But she knew what she was doing, she knew that there was a line that no dog should cross and she stood behind that line for many years.
​Two Dogs Take Down Big Drug DealerThis was one bust that us three always talked about in our highly secret and secured location. We had managed to successfully take down one of the biggest drug dealers in Mexico. It all played out like this; Nica got invitation to go to a fancy party in one of the most secured upscale communities. She picked out a drop dead outfit which would make any dog loose his sense of scent. All eyes were on her as she gingerly scrolled in, fur curly over one eye, paws gently strutting. The kingpin saw her and immediately went over to boast to party members about him being good friends with the lovely Nica, even though it was the first time she had actually spoken to Roberto Emmanuel.
He invited her to a private section of the party which was cordoned off. They were all having a good time, drinking and feasting on bacon strips. Nica was standing near Roberto when he suddenly took out his phone to read a text message. The message informed Roberto that the drug shipment would arrive at a certain port at a certain time and he needs to be there in person for the exchange of money and drugs. Nica was a pro, she could read your messages from a mile away. As soon as Roberto replied and confirmed, she simply vanished into the crowd.Venom, Nica, myself and a few out of state police made arrangements for the bust the next day.
Roberto was foolish enough to come to the location to exchange the money for the drugs. This was going to be deadly as both sides were armed to the teeth. As the exchange ended, immediately the team swooped down on them. All hell broke loose, bullets flew from all angles as the drug dealers tried feverishly to escape. Nica and Venom were ready for action. They wore mask to protect their identities. Back to back, we moved in on the criminals. Taking out who never obeyed the command to drop their weapons and seize fire. We were a team, many thought of us similar to the Justice League. We watched each others back in the melee. Soon, the law had won and Roberto and his cronies were arrested that night. He was charged and convicted and is now doing 30 years of hard time.
